What is uPVC?
uPVC, or unplasticized polyvinyl chloride, is a stiff form of PVC that is totally free from plasticizers, making it highly resilient and long-lasting. Unlike wood, metal, or other conventional materials, uPVC is resistant to moisture, weather, and corrosion, making it a perfect option for both residential and business residential or commercial properties.

Advantages of uPVC Windows and Doors
1. Energy Efficiency
Among the standout functions of uPVC doors and windows is their superior insulation homes. They are designed to reduce heat loss, helping to keep your home warm in winter season and cool in summertime. The multi-chambered frames of uPVC doors and windows produce a thermal barrier, while double or triple-glazing choices further improve energy efficiency. This can result in an obvious decrease in energy bills and a lower carbon footprint.

2. Low Maintenance
Unlike wood windows and doors that require routine sanding, painting, or polishing, uPVC needs minimal upkeep. It doesn't warp, rot, or corrode when exposed to wetness or extreme climate condition. An easy clean with a moist fabric is all it takes to keep uPVC frames looking fresh and clean for years.

3. Sturdiness
uPVC is incredibly strong and can endure long-term direct exposure to severe components without losing its structural integrity. Its resistance to rust, rot, and UV rays ensures that your windows and doors preserve their look and performance over time.

4. Boosted Security
Security is a leading priority for any home, and uPVC doors and windows deliver on this front. They are engineered with multi-point locking systems and enhanced frames, making them robust and hard to tamper with. This includes an additional layer of protection to your property.

5. Weather Resistance
Whether you reside in an area prone to heavy rains, scorching heat, or freezing temperatures, uPVC windows and doors can withstand everything. Their weather resistance prevents water leak, fading, and thermal growth, ensuring they remain untouched by changing climate conditions.



6. Sound Reduction
If you live in a dynamic city or near a hectic roadway, sound pollution can be a significant concern. uPVC windows and doors provide considerable soundproofing, particularly when paired with double-glazed glass. This assists create a relaxing indoor environment, allowing you to take pleasure in a tranquil home.

7. Aesthetic Appeal
Available in a wide variety of colors, styles, and finishes, uPVC doors and windows use flexibility in design to fit any architectural appearance. Whether you choose a crisp white surface, a timber-like appearance, or something more modern and streamlined, uPVC frames can be tailored to match your home's aesthetic.

8. Eco-Friendly Solution
uPVC is a recyclable material, making it a sustainable option for environmentally-conscious house owners. By selecting uPVC, you're contributing to lowered waste and supporting a greener planet. Additionally, their energy performance further supports environment-friendly living.

Applications of uPVC in Your Home
uPVC doors and windows can be utilized in a range of methods to enhance your home's performance and design:

Sash Windows: Ideal for ventilation and maximum light.
Sliding Windows: Perfect for little spaces and easy operation.
French Doors: Elegant and versatile, appropriate for patios or lounges.
Tilt-and-Turn Windows: Provide flexibility in ventilation and simple cleaning gain access to.
Bay Windows: Add a touch of elegance while developing a cozy nook.
uPVC vs. Traditional Materials
While conventional wood and aluminum windows and doors have their own charm, uPVC typically exceeds them in regards to resilience, affordability, and practicality. Wood, for example, is prone to termites, wetness damage, and requires periodic upkeep. Aluminum, although strong, can perform heat easily, which might jeopardize energy efficiency. uPVC combines the best of both worlds by being resilient, economical, and energy-efficient.
